Location and Accessibility
Hosteeva Newly Renovated Condos Near French Quarter are strategically located at 1014 Canal St, New Orleans, LA 70112, USA. For anyone familiar with New Orleans, Canal Street is a major thoroughfare that serves as a vibrant gateway to the city's most famous attractions. This prime address puts guests just steps away from the historic French Quarter, meaning you can easily walk to Bourbon Street, Jackson Square, and a myriad of world-renowned restaurants, music venues, and unique shops.
The accessibility from this location is a significant advantage. The Canal Streetcar line is literally at your doorstep, offering a charming and efficient way to explore various parts of the city, including the Central Business District, Warehouse District, and further into the Garden District if you choose. This public transportation option significantly reduces the need for private vehicles or expensive taxi rides, making it incredibly convenient for sightseeing. Additionally, the condos are within a comfortable walking distance to major venues like the Caesars Superdome and Smoothie King Center, making them an excellent choice for those attending sports events or concerts. The proximity to landmarks like the Saenger Theatre and the bustling shopping on Canal Street also adds to the appeal, ensuring that entertainment and conveniences are always within easy reach. While parking in the city can be challenging, the central location minimizes the need for a car, allowing you to truly immerse yourself in the walkable magic of New Orleans.

Oct 03, 2023 · Bill Mohl1014 Canal Street New Orleans - June 2024. Stayed 5 nights, 2 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ms, one shower. Right in our condo was a washer and dryer - lovely to have!!! Due to no detergent, we just used the rinse cycle - purchase if you wanted (convenience stores very close). Quiet overall. Clean condo with a couple bath towels for each person, with small stove, fridge, microwave and fridge/freezer. Cutlery, plates, cups, and skillets provided. Living room area was nice to have as well. Very happy with the location. Just a couple blocks from Bourbon Street, walkable. Also the pick up for the RTA Bus and Street Car was right in front of our building. Highly recommend downloading the "LePass" app to use - we paid $15 for 7 days, but you can also pay for a single day $1.25, 3 days, etc. Very useful! Condo around the corner from CVS, Walgreens, Beer/Liquor store - nice to buy some essentials while there. Would use again!!!
